Class FileTransfer


  • public class FileTransfer
    extends ByteArrayTransfer
    The class FileTransfer provides a platform specific mechanism for converting a list of files represented as a java String[] to a platform specific representation of the data and vice versa. Each String in the array contains the absolute path for a single file or directory.

    An example of a java String[] containing a list of files is shown below:

         File file1 = new File("C:\temp\file1");
         File file2 = new File("C:\temp\file2");
         String[] fileData = new String[2];
         fileData[0] = file1.getAbsolutePath();
         fileData[1] = file2.getAbsolutePath();

      • javaToNative

        public void javaToNative​(java.lang.Object object,
                                 TransferData transferData)
        This implementation of javaToNative converts a list of file names represented by a java String[] to a platform specific representation. Each String in the array contains the absolute path for a single file or directory.
        Overrides:
        javaToNative in class ByteArrayTransfer
        Parameters:
        object - a java String[] containing the file names to be converted
        transferData - an empty TransferData object that will be filled in on return with the platform specific format of the data
        See Also:
        Transfer.nativeToJava(org.eclipse.swt.dnd.TransferData)
      • nativeToJava

        public java.lang.Object nativeToJava​(TransferData transferData)
        This implementation of nativeToJava converts a platform specific representation of a list of file names to a java String[]. Each String in the array contains the absolute path for a single file or directory.
        Overrides:
        nativeToJava in class ByteArrayTransfer
        Parameters:
        transferData - the platform specific representation of the data to be converted
        Returns:
        a java String[] containing a list of file names if the conversion was successful; otherwise null
